The Presiding Officer is from Virginia, and I know he understands military men and women very well. It is a very patriotic State when it comes to their military footprint. I am confident that he and I--and others--will be able to fix the problem that occurred in the budget agreement. Let me say about the agreement itself that I do appreciate the fact that we were able to find a bipartisan way forward to relieve sequestration from the military and nonmilitary for a couple of years. That is just a drop in the bucket as far as what we have to do to repair the military. GDP spending on the military is moving toward an alltime low over a 10-year period with sequestration. The historical average has been well over 4 percent, and we are going to hit below 3 percent if we continue sequestration. That is an issue for another day. The budget agreement called for relieving sequestration in the pay- fors. Quite frankly, they were not big. They did not change the course of the country. They are not what the Senator from Virginia and I hoped for. We would have liked to have done entitlement reform. I would like to do Tax Code simplification. I am willing to eliminate deductions in the Tax Code and take some of the money to pay down the debt, even though some folks on my side say we have to put it all in tax reductions. And I think the Senator from Virginia would be willing to engage in commonsense entitlement reform to keep us from becoming Greece. This was the best deal we could get.…
